23.4 A2ICAN Connections and Jumper Configurations
23.4.1 LR72 Connections
The expansion card connects to the LR72 board using two (2) connectors: one 2-pin connector
for the power supply (VI+ and GND), and a 5-pin connector for the CAN bus. See Table 28.
Table 30. A2ICAN Connections to LR72 Board (see Figure 48.)
2-Pin Connector
Name
Function
GND
Ground
+VI
DC power supply between 8 and 30V
5-Pin Connector
Name
Function
VCAN
Power Supply
CANH
CANH bus signal (CAN high)
GNDCAN
Ground (Shielding)
CANL
CANL bus signal (CAN low)
GNDCAN
CAN Ground
23.5 Outputs
Each Analog Output has two serial relays that switch the output signal in one of two ways: Direct
or Inverse. If none of the relays are activated, these outputs (Direct and Inverse) are
disconnected.
23.5.1 Output PWM1
Output1 is connected to the 4-pole terminal block shown in Figure 48.
Table 31. Output PWM1 Connections
5-Pin Connector
Name
Function
VPP1
Channel 1 power
GND1
Channel 1 ground
VO1
Channel 1 Direct Analog PWM output
VR1
Channel 1 Inverse Analog PWM output
23.5.2 Output PWM2
Output2 is connected to the 4-pole terminal block shown in Figure 48.
Table 32. Output PWM2 Connections
5-Pin Connector
Name
Function
VPP2
Channel 2 power
GND2
Channel 2 ground
VO2
Channel 2 Direct Analog PWM output
VR2
Channel 2 Inverse Analog PWM output
